For those who may have long since forgotten their youth, Conejo Players Theatre presents a children’s theatre production of Delia Ephron’s "How to Eat Like a Child and Other Lessons in Not Being a Grown-up." The fast-paced musical will be performed at 1 and 4 p.m. Sat. and Sun., Sept. 21, 22, 28 and 29 at 351 S. Moorpark Road, Thousand Oaks.
The play is a romp through the joys and sorrows of being a child, touching on such typical kids’ hijinks as: how to beg for a dog; how to torture your sister; how to act after being sent to your room; and how to laugh hysterically.
Director Elsje Linda Chun has directed many family-oriented Broadway musical productions for the Conejo Valley Unified School District.
